Curtis "Curt" Maddox was the sixth head college football coach for the Mississippi Valley State University Delta Devils located in Itta Bena, Mississippi, and he held that position for two seasons, from 1966 until 1967. His coaching record at Mississippi Valley State was 4 wins, 14 losses, and 0 ties. As of the conclusion of the 2007 season, this ranks him 11th at Mississippi Valley State in total wins and in winning percentage (.222).
